随着区块链技术的不断发展,越来越多人开始接触和使用加密货币。HD(Hierarchical Deterministic)钱包作为一种备受欢迎的加密货币钱包类型,因其能够管理大量的地址和密钥而被广泛采用。在本篇文章中,我们将深入探讨HD钱包的主公钥和新公钥,以及如何有效地管理它们。与此同时,本文将回答几个关于HD钱包及其密钥管理的关键问题。
HD钱包,或称为层次确定性钱包,允许用户从一个主密钥生成无限数量的子密钥。与传统钱包不同,HD钱包通过利用BIP32(Bitcoin Improvement Proposal 32)标准,实现了以一种层次化的方式生成密钥。这种方式使得用户只需备份主密钥,就可以恢复所有与之关联的密钥。
HD钱包的主要优点在于它的安全性和便利性。传统钱包需要对应每一个地址进行备份,而在HD钱包中,用户只需要记住一组助记词或备份主公钥,就可以恢复整个钱包。这样一来,HD钱包大大降低了丢失私人密钥风险,提高了资金管理的安全性。
HD钱包中的主公钥(Master Public Key)是从主密钥生成的,不同于私人密钥,主公钥并不允许用户进行签名或访问钱包中的资金。它主要用于生成子公钥和提供给其他方,以便于收款。在多数情况下,用户在创建HD钱包时会获得一个主公钥,这个公钥将用于生成一系列的子公钥。
新公钥则是指从主公钥生成的特定公钥,它们是专门为某个交易或者接收特定加密货币而生成的。这些新公钥是分层结构的一部分,每个新公钥都是在主公钥基础上衍生出的一部分。通过新公钥,用户可以接收加密货币而无需暴露自己的主公钥,提高了隐私保护。
HD钱包的钥匙管理相对简单。一旦创建一个HD钱包,系统便会自动生成主公钥与相应的新公钥。用户可以通过个性化设置或者使用特定的应用来生成新公钥。在大多数HD钱包中,用户只需点击生成新地址或新公钥的按钮,系统便会为其提供新的公钥。
重要的是,用户在管理这些公钥时,应该定期检查和记录自己生成的新公钥。此外,使用好的密码管理工具,确保各个公钥的安全性也是极为关键。如果用户希望使用一个特定的新公钥接收资金,那么务必要把它提供给付款方,而不是主公钥,以降低泄露风险。
使用HD钱包具有一定的安全性,但这些安全性依赖于用户对其密钥的管理。即便HD钱包为用户提供了良好的密钥管理和备份机制,但用户仍需秉持安全意识。发生钥匙丢失或暴露的风险仍然存在。
因此,用户在管理HD钱包时应采取一些措施来保障钱包安全。例如,强烈建议使用强密码保护钱包,避免在不安全的网络环境下进行操作,并开启双重认证。此外,定期备份主密钥和助记词也是必不可少的环节,有助于在钱包丢失的情况下进行恢复。
HD钱包的使用有很多显著的优点。首先,它允许用户从一个主密钥生成多个子密钥,大幅简化了密钥管理。其次,HD钱包提供了更高的隐私保护,因为每次转账或收款可以使用不同的地址,避免了资金流动的追踪。此外,它的恢复功能让用户不再担心密钥丢失问题,只需保留一个主密钥和助记词,就能恢复整个钱包。而且,HD钱包具有优秀的跨平台兼容性,可以在不同的设备和应用中使用,非常方便。
备份HD钱包的关键在于备份主密钥和助记词。用户可以采用多种方式进行备份,例如将助记词写下来并保存在安全的地方,或者使用密码管理工具进行数字化存储。不管采用何种方式,重要的是确保备份的数据尽量不容易被他人获取,并且能在需要时快速找到。
同时,用户需定期验证备份的主密钥和助记词是否有效,确保在恢复钱包时不出现问题。在备份期间,避免在不安全的环境中执行任何操作,以防数据被截获或盗窃。
确保HD钱包的安全主要依靠用户的安全意识和日常习惯。首先,设置强而独特的密码,且定期更换。其次,开启双重认证功能,增加额外的安全层。此外,尽量避免使用公共网络访问钱包,使用虚拟专用网(VPN)可有效提升安全性。在处理密钥时,也需谨慎操作,绝不要在不信任的设备或应用中输入助记词。
虽然HD钱包提供了优越的安全性和方便的管理特性,但任何钱包的安全性都完全依赖于用户的操作习惯。若用户失去对主密钥或助记词的控制,任何加密货币的存储均会面临风险。此外,HD钱包并不可避免地存在技术漏洞的可能,因此及时更新钱包版本和使用知名品牌的钱包能够有效降低风险。
总而言之,HD钱包为用户提供了安全且方便的加密货币管理方式,通过合理使用主公钥和新公钥,可以最大程度地保护用户的数字资产。然而,在使用HD钱包的过程中,不断提升自己的安全意识,重视密钥保护和备份,是保障安全的关键所在。